Le Surcouf is a welcoming French restaurant established in a Victorian home for over 45 years now. Dominique and the chef Serge will be pleased to help you discover the fine French classic cuisine. In the fall the restaurant offers a special game menu in addition to their regular table d'hôte that you create yourself.
Le Surcouf consistently earns praise for excellent French cuisine, impeccable service, and a warm, elegant atmosphere in a charming old house with multiple intimate rooms. The wine list is excellent and dietary needs are well accommodated with gluten free options, making it a reliable choice for special occasions and relaxed dinners alike. While some guests note that prices can be on the higher side and that service can be slower on busy nights, the overall experience remains memorable and consistently high quality.
